Hotel JAL City Nagano
10/10 Excellent
"I stayed at the JAL for 8 nights and was happy with the service. The location is great as it is a short walk to Zenkoji Temple, the Prefectural Museum and also to Nagano JR Station. Nagano was a fascinating city to visit and the JAL was situated in a good location for finding amenities such as shopping and food. I love to walk and I really enjoyed exploring the area around the hotel. The staff were very helpful and friendly. Although my room was rather crowded with 3 beds, it was kept clean and well stocked. My only complaint was that the breakfast for a Westerner was very limited and got predictable very quickly. The food was very good, presented well and tasted fine but after 8 breakfasts eating the same things I was ready for a change."
